About The Book: The book, "Narrative of Tours in India," chronicles the extensive travels of Lord Connemara, Governor of Madras, from 1886 to 1890. Covering regions like Coimbatore, Bellary, and Kurnool, it delves into encounters with local rulers, historical explorations, and community interactions. The narrative extends to cities such as Darjeeling, Calcutta, and Bombay, offering insights into colonial governance, cultural diversity, and economic activities. From Coconada to Hyderabad, it provides a comprehensive view of the regions visited, highlighting aspects of administration, societal customs, and regional development. Lord Connemara's journeys serve of India's diverse landscapes, people, and historical significance during the late 19th century. About The Author: Sir John David Rees, 1st Baronet, KCIE, CVO, was a colonial administrator in British India and later a Member of Parliament for the Liberal Party. Rees' legacy encompasses his significant contributions to colonial governance and his political service in Westminster.
